Output f0ba5438d81e4723e890ecfaf7fd2f104457643b3d55fbe42367c495974803b8:1

value
324633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17a331b1c66db09ce2d94b0581c0fbcd1649ca0 OP_EQUAL
address
3KL2j9SXYkHZFB7FdT384M794eRcfw35Js
transaction
f0ba5438d81e4723e890ecfaf7fd2f104457643b3d55fbe42367c495974803b8
confirmations
313894
spent
true